This time round, Apple's iPhone lives to tell a different kind of story...
According to reports, just as there were enthusiasts waiting to get their hands on the iPhone, there were these tech freaks who made a mad dash to dismantle the device...
They all but ended up revealing the innards of the iPhone -- something that Apple had tried hard to conceal...
